Use logarithmic units for basic block alignment.
This was actually a bit of a mess. TLI.setPrefLoopAlignment was clearly documented as taking log2(bytes) units, but the x86 target would still set a preferred loop alignment of '16'. CodePlacementOpt passed this number on to the basic block, and AsmPrinter interpreted it as bytes. Now both MachineFunction and MachineBasicBlock use logarithmic alignments. Obviously, MachineConstantPool still measures alignments in bytes, so we can emulate the thrill of using as.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@145889 91177308-0d34-0410-b5e6-96231b3b80d8
